A person is attracted toward the center of Earth by a gravitational force of 500 N. The force with which Earth is attracted toward the person is

1) 500 N
2) infinitesimally small
3) billions and billions of tons

principally because
4) the forces in question make an action/reaction pair.
5) the mass of the person is negligible compared to the mass of Earth.
6) Earth itself weighs billions and billions of tons.
7) of inertia.


Answer: 1, 4
